Improve non-English matching (#374) #3093
This run and associated checks have been archived and are scheduled for deletion.
Learn more about checks retention
Annotations
4 errors, 4 warnings, and 1 notice
[extension] › incontext-signup.extension.spec.js:14:5 › chrome extension › should allow user to sign up for Email Protection:
integration-test/helpers/pages.js#L34
1) [extension] › incontext-signup.extension.spec.js:14:5 › chrome extension › should allow user to sign up for Email Protection
TimeoutError: locator.click: Timeout 500ms exceeded.
=========================== logs ===========================
waiting for locator('text=Protect My Email')
locator resolved to <a target="_blank" class="primary js-get-email-sign…>↵ Protect My Email↵ </a>
attempting click action
waiting for element to be visible, enabled and stable
============================================================
at ../helpers/pages.js:34
32 | }
33 | async getEmailProtection () {
> 34 | (await getCallToAction()).click({timeout: 500})
| ^
35 | }
36 | async dismissTooltipWith (text) {
37 | const dismissTooltipButton = await page.locator(`text=${text}`)
at IncontextSignupPage.getEmailProtection (/home/runner/work/duckduckgo-autofill/duckduckgo-autofill/integration-test/helpers/pages.js:34:39)
at /home/runner/work/duckduckgo-autofill/duckduckgo-autofill/integration-test/tests/incontext-signup.extension.spec.js:32:9
|
[extension] › incontext-signup.extension.spec.js:14:5 › chrome extension › should allow user to sign up for Email Protection:
integration-test/tests/incontext-signup.extension.spec.js#L1
1) [extension] › incontext-signup.extension.spec.js:14:5 › chrome extension › should allow user to sign up for Email Protection
Test timeout of 30000ms exceeded.
|
[macos] › email-autofill.macos.spec.js:218:9 › macos › auto filling a signup form › with an identity + Email Protection:
integration-test/helpers/pages.js#L173
2) [macos] › email-autofill.macos.spec.js:218:9 › macos › auto filling a signup form › with an identity + Email Protection, autofill using duck address in identity triggered from name field
Error: unreachable - password must not be empty
at ../helpers/pages.js:173
171 |
172 | if (!generatedPassword.trim()) {
> 173 | throw new Error('unreachable - password must not be empty')
| ^
174 | }
175 |
176 | await passwordBtn.click({ force: true })
at SignupPage.selectGeneratedPassword (/home/runner/work/duckduckgo-autofill/duckduckgo-autofill/integration-test/helpers/pages.js:173:23)
at /home/runner/work/duckduckgo-autofill/duckduckgo-autofill/integration-test/tests/email-autofill.macos.spec.js:232:13
|
[macos] › mutating-form.macos.spec.js:19:5 › Mutating form page › works fine on macOS:
integration-test/helpers/pages.js#L309
3) [macos] › mutating-form.macos.spec.js:19:5 › Mutating form page › works fine on macOS ─────────
Error: expect(received).toBeFalsy()
Received: "background-size: auto 100% !important; background-position: right !important; background-repeat: no-repeat !important; background-origin: content-box !important; background-image: url(\"\") !important; transition: background !important;"
at ../helpers/pages.js:309
307 | }
308 | async assertPasswordHasNoIcon () {
> 309 | expect(await passwordStyleAttr()).toBeFalsy()
| ^
310 | }
311 | }
312 |
at SignupPage.assertPasswordHasNoIcon (/home/runner/work/duckduckgo-autofill/duckduckgo-autofill/integration-test/helpers/pages.js:309:47)
at /home/runner/work/duckduckgo-autofill/duckduckgo-autofill/integration-test/tests/mutating-form.macos.spec.js:34:9
|
test
The following actions uses node12 which is deprecated and will be forced to run on node16: actions/cache@v2, actions/upload-artifact@v2. For more info: https://github.blog/changelog/2023-06-13-github-actions-all-actions-will-run-on-node16-instead-of-node12-by-default/
|
Slow Test:
[macos] › login-form.macos.spec.js#L1
[macos] › login-form.macos.spec.js took 38.5s
|
Slow Test:
[extension] › incontext-signup.extension.spec.js#L1
[extension] › incontext-signup.extension.spec.js took 19.3s
|
Slow Test:
[macos] › email-autofill.macos.spec.js#L1
[macos] › email-autofill.macos.spec.js took 18.1s
|
🎭 Playwright Run Summary
3 flaky
[extension] › incontext-signup.extension.spec.js:14:5 › chrome extension › should allow user to sign up for Email Protection
[macos] › email-autofill.macos.spec.js:218:9 › macos › auto filling a signup form › with an identity + Email Protection, autofill using duck address in identity triggered from name field
[macos] › mutating-form.macos.spec.js:19:5 › Mutating form page › works fine on macOS ──────────
1 skipped
98 passed (2.7m)
|
Artifacts
Produced during runtime
Name | Size | |
---|---|---|
playwright-results
Expired
|
340 KB |
|